day 1 Rome-Tivoli-Marmore Falls-Spoleto-Assisi

Meeting with our guide and minibus in the hotel lobby at 08.30. Departure to Tivoli, beautiful village in the sorroundings of Rome, famous for its villas, UNESCO World Heritage. Visit of the old town. Time at your own for visit and lunch. In the afternoon, on the way to Spoleto, short stop at Marmore to admire the most beautiful Italian falls in the heart of Umbria. Continuation to Spoleto, city of 40,000 inhabitants of Roman origin that keeps symbolic monuments like the Bridge of the Towers or the Arch of Drusus and more recent like the Cathedral and the Albornozian Rock. Afternoon arrival to Assisi.

day 2 Assisi- Perugia-Todi-Assisi

This morning a nice walk in the old town of Assisi will end with a visit of the Basilica of Saint Francis. Then departure for the capital of the Umbrian region, ancient Etruscan center and rich city of history and art. Visit of the city. You can admire the Palazzo dei Priori, the Fontana Mayor, the Etruscan Gate of the 3rd century BC, the Cathedral and the medieval wall. Free time for lunch. Continue for Todi. In the afternoon, stroll through the historic center of this pretty walled village and protected by the Rock of 1373; you can see the Cathedral, the People's Square, the Palace of Priors and the Church of Consolation, built by Bramante. Return to Assisi via panoramic itinerary.

day 3 Assisi-Gubbio-Citta di Castello-Assisi

In the morning after breakfast visit of the Basilica of Santa Maria degli Angeli at the bottom of the hill of Assisi. Departure to Gubbio, a beautiful city that is located 500 meters above sea level and shows traces of different dominations, from the Roman to the papal. Highlights include the Cathedral, the Ducal Palace, the Capitán's Palace and the Palacio de los Consules. Continuation for Città di Castello and lunch at your leisure. In the afternoon, visit the city, the largest center of the Upper Tiber Valley, which presents narrow and picturesque streets along with majestic and elegant squares, where some of the historical palaces of greater interest and beauty arise. Return to Assisi.

day 4 Assisi-Orvieto-Siena

After breakfast leave Assisi to reach the most important city on the way between Umbria and Rome: Orvieto. Only the Gothic Cathedral, imposing and elaborate, would be worth the visit to admire its façade but the city of Pozo de San Patricio, offers nice corners to breathe the medieval air of the city, try the excellent wines or the renowned food. Visit and free time for lunch. Departure to Siena and afternoon at leisure in the old town.

day 5 Siena-San Gimignano-Volterra-Siena

Morning dedicated to the visit of the city. Surrounded by the Chianti woods on one side, from the hills on the other, the city seems to extend over a low hill, in a central position with respect to the lands that have always been its domain. The famous city of Palio and contrada fascinates by the thousands of colors of its flags, its twisted streets, the perfection of its gothic monuments, the fame of its illustrious children and the taste of the products that can be tried here. Departure to San Gimignano, the "city of the Towers", where you will visit Porta San Giovanni, Cisterna Square, Palazzo del Popolo, the Civic Museum and San Agostino. Free time for lunch. Continuation for Volterra. Located on the highest point of a high hill, the city with its austere and medieval silhouette is famous for its alabaster craftsmanship. Visit of the city with the Square and the Priori Palace, Duomo, Baptistery, Pinacoteca and Civic Museum. Departure to Siena.

day 6 Siena-Chianti Route-Lucca-Siena

After breakfast,, take the Strada del Chianti - Ruta del Chianti - the most famous wine in Italy. Along the way, you can see the charming hills, the picturesque villages with their ancient towers, the farms and of course the vineyards. Visit Castellina in Chianti, the old town and its walls. Then visit Greve in Chianti with its asymmetrical square with porches and terraces. Lunch. at your leisure. Departure towards Lucca, a city surrounded by a wall of walls that has been preserved whole. Visit Napoleone Square, Province Palace, Duomo, Piazza San Martino and Piazza Anfiteatro. Then return to Siena.

day 7 Siena-Montepulciano-Pienza-Montalcino-Rome

Departure to Montepulciano. The town, an art pearl of 1500, is located 750 meters above sea level on top of a hill near the Val of Chiana, in a territory already inhabited in the Etruscan and Roman times. It is owed its fame mainly by the production of the wine "Nobile", red of great quality. Continuation for Pienza. This city, on top of a hill overlooking the Orcia Valley, is an essential stage for its artistic beauties and the good gastronomy typical of the place. The famous Piazza Pio II, Renaissance, overlooks the Cathedral, the Piccolomini Palace, the Palazzo Comunale, Borgia Palace and the wonderful panoramic promenade along the walls, which at one glance allows you to see the entire valley closed in the bottom for Mount Amiata. Exit towards Montalcino; the great fortress characterizes the city, which looms over the three Asso, d'Aria and Orcia valleys. Luch at your leisure and then continue to Rome where your tour comes to an end.
